Though there are a number of reasons that WCW died, historically, a lot of the blame has gone to the company paying wrestlers way above market value. While WCW would still have lost tens of millions of dollars in the year 2000 even if every wrestler had worked for free, there’s no question that a the pay scale was out of control and often made little sense. They were in a promotional war, and the ability to outbid the WWF was one of the clear advantages they had. Even if they weren’t actually outbidding anyone in practice.
When Sonny Onoo and other former WCW talent sued the company in a racial discrimination lawsuit in 2000, among the documents released to the plaintiffs in the discovery process were various printouts of WCW’s roster databases, emails pertaining to contract negotiations, and so on.
